Babolat Drive Junior 23" Tennis Racquet
The Babolat Drive Junior 23" brings the heritage and performance DNA of the legendary Pure Drive adult line to the 23-inch junior format — a beginner-to-intermediate development racquet for children aged 6 to 9 that provides the responsive, power-oriented character of the Drive platform in a properly scaled, lightweight junior frame. The Drive Junior 23" is Babolat's value-positioned junior racquet for this developmental size, offering quality construction and proper specifications without the premium pricing of the signature Carlitos or Nadal series — an excellent choice for families seeking genuine Babolat performance at an accessible entry price.
- Pure Drive Heritage in Junior Format - The Drive Junior series descends directly from Babolat's Pure Drive adult platform — the same power-oriented design philosophy, the same emphasis on generating ball speed with an accessible, forgiving string bed, and the same Babolat construction quality that has made the Pure Drive the world's best-selling adult performance racquet. Young players who develop on the Drive Junior series build familiarity with the Pure Drive's hitting characteristics, making the eventual transition to a full adult Pure Drive or Pure Drive Team a natural, seamless continuation rather than a jarring change in racquet character.
- 23-Inch Developmental Length - At 23 inches, the Drive Junior reaches the size where children begin to develop real technical mechanics rather than just making contact — the frame is long enough to generate meaningful ball speed on properly struck shots, providing positive feedback that rewards good technique and begins to build the intrinsic motivation to hit the ball well. This is the critical technique-building window in junior development, and the Drive Junior 23"'s specifications are calibrated to support good swing habits rather than simply facilitating contact.
- Orange-to-Green Ball Transition Coverage - The Drive Junior 23" serves players through the orange ball stage and into the green ball transition — the developmental bridge between modified junior formats and the standard adult ball and court dimensions. The racquet's weight and string bed are appropriate for both slower orange balls used on short courts and the slightly faster green balls that players encounter as they approach the competitive junior level, making it a practical choice that serves players through multiple stages of their development without requiring an immediate equipment change.

- Beginner Technique Forgiveness - The Drive Junior 23"'s string bed and weight provide enough forgiveness for the imperfect, developing contact that characterizes early-stage junior players — off-center hits produce usable ball flight that gives children positive feedback and keeps practice sessions constructive rather than frustrating. This forgiveness does not eliminate the performance benefit of centered contact, which ensures the racquet continues to reward improving technique as children develop more consistent mechanics over months of practice.

Racquet Specs — Babolat Drive Junior 23"
| Length | 23 in |
| Pre-strung | Yes |
| Composition | Graphite Composite |
| Grip Size | 0 (4" grip) |
| Recommended age | 6–8 (approx) |
